The HG 1/144 Ryusei-Go (Graze Custom II) from Iron-Blooded Orphans is aimed at modellers who appreciate mechanical detail and freedom of movement. The kit presents clear part breaks and joint work that reward careful assembly.
The kit's joint arrangement supports varied posing while retaining good stability. Shoulder and knee joints are particularly effective for both dynamic and neutral displays.
Listed as a moderate build, the kit is accessible with basic modeller tools. A set of side cutters, a precision hobby knife and tweezers will help with neat nubbing and small part placement.
To enhance the engraved details, use gentle sanding and panel lining. Apply decals carefully, then protect the work with a clear topcoat for a consistent finish.
